England-Serbia wins easily. Canale5 holds with ‘Family Secrets’, Cala Report

The debut match at the European football championships of the National team of the three lions at 28.7% on Rai1, while the Turkish drama on Canale 5 does not reach the two million mark. ‘Report’ rises to the podium with around 1.3 million, the film Rai2 beats Italia1’s comedy. With Vannacci as guest Brindisi beats Augias, but ‘Babele’ is a repeat on Berlinguer with Veltroni as guest.

The European football championships are still protagonists on TV, throughout Sunday and in the evening on a still contrasting – climatically speaking – 16th June. In prime time there was England-Serbia on Rai 1 (and on Sky), which ended with the narrow victory of the whites by 1-0 with a goal from Bellingham, against the Slavic team which fielded many players who play in the championship in its ranks Italian.

‘Against’ the match, Canale 5 programmed the new Turkish drama, ‘Segreti di Famiglia’, Rai2 turned pink with the film ‘Il Velo Nuziale’, while Italia 1 relied on Aldo Giovanni and Giacomo (‘Così è la life’). While the information triad completed the picture, with the investigations of ‘Report’ on the third network (water, accidents at work among the topics), ‘Zona Bianca’ on Rete 4 (Roberto Vannacci), ‘La Torre di Babele’ (Corrado Augias in reply on Enrico Berlinguer with Walter Veltroni as guest) on La7. Here’s how Auditel lined up the various proposals.

They win the European Football Championships and then ‘European Nights’ at 12.5%. Canale5’s Turkish drama series is ‘saved’, with Ranucci third

On Rai1 for Euro 2024, the Serbia-England match attracted 4,865,000 viewers with a 28.7% share. Immediately after, the show of ‘Notti Europee’ with Paola Ferrari and Marco Mazzocchi hosting it attracted 1,069,000 spectators with 12.5%.

On Canale5 the Turkish drama ‘Family Secrets’ achieved 1,984,000 viewers and a 13.3% share.

On Rai3 Sigfrido Ranucci with ‘Report’ reached 1,285,000 viewers with a 7.5.

On Rai2 the film ‘Il Velo Nuziale’ had 818,000 viewers and 4.8%. On Italia1 the comedy ‘Così è la vita’ convinced 782,000 spectators with a 5% share.

On Rete4 ‘Zona Bianca’ with Roberto Vannacci guest of Giuseppe Brindisi attracted 673,000 spectators with a 5.4% share.

On La7 the repeat of ‘The Tower of Babel – What remains of Berlinguer?’ it had 585,000 spectators with 3.4%.
